SportsLine model releases NBA picks for Sunday games

The SportsLine Projection Model has picks for Sunday's NBA games between Knicks-Wizards, Celtics-Timberwolves and Raptors-Suns. It recommends Knicks -19.5, over 219.5 points for Celtics-Timberwolves and Raptors -2.5. The model simulates each game 10,000 times.

The NBA regular season nears its end, with key late-season matchups on Sunday. According to CBS Sports, the SportsLine Projection Model, which has gone 42-20 on top-rated NBA spread picks since last season, targets three games for bets at DraftKings Sportsbook. For Knicks vs. Wizards, the model picks New York -19.5 at -115 odds, projecting a cover in 67% of simulations. Washington enters on a 15-game losing streak with the second-worst record in the league. The Knicks have won five straight and pursue the Eastern Conference No. 2 seed, though Josh Hart is questionable with a knee issue. In Celtics vs. Timberwolves, the pick is over 219.5 points at -115 odds, hitting in 68% of simulations. Boston sits second in the East, while Minnesota holds sixth in the West after reaching the conference finals from that spot last year. The teams combined for at least 230 points in their previous two meetings, including Minnesota's 119-115 home win on November 29 last year. For Raptors vs. Suns, Toronto -2.5 at -112 odds covers in 56% of simulations. Phoenix faces a play-in tournament spot with six players out, while Toronto pushes for a top-six East position and is relatively healthier.
